![]() "Mendele Mocher Sforim's 'The Wanderings of Benjamin III' is a captivating and thought-provoking novel that dives deep into the complexities of identity, religion, and tradition. The story follows Benjamin, a young Jewish man on a journey of self-discovery and enlightenment as he navigates the challenges of living in a changing world. Sforim's writing is rich in detail and emotion, painting a vivid picture of Benjamin's experiences and struggles. The novel is filled with moments of humor, sadness, and introspection, making it a truly engaging read. Through Benjamin's encounters with various characters and cultures, Sforim explores themes of cultural assimilation, the clash of tradition and modernity, and the search for one's own place in the world. The novel's powerful message about staying true to oneself while adapting to new surroundings is both relevant and inspiring. Overall, 'The Wanderings of Benjamin III' is a beautifully written and thought-provoking novel that will resonate with readers of all backgrounds.
